ECI set to announce bye-polls for Budgam and Nagrota seats

Srinagar:The Election Commission of India (ECI) is set to announce bye-polls for Budgam and Nagrota assembly segments, sources disclosed.
Sources told the news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O) that the poll body could announce the schedule for two seats anytime from now. “It could be announced this week or early next week,” they said.
While Omar Abdullah, who won Budgam and Ganderbal seats in the last year’s election, decided to vacate the former on October 21, Nagrota seat fell vacant on October 31 due to the demise of Devinder Singh Rana.
The election for both the seats has to be completed by April 20 as a bye-election for filling any vacancy shall be held within a period of six months from the date of the occurrence of the vacancy.
It could be delayed beyond the six-month timeline only if the Election Commission of India (ECI) in consultation with the central government certifies that it is difficult to hold the bye-election within the said period—(KNO)
